Q: Is 86,774,840 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 86,774,840 is a composite number.

Why is 86,774,840 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 86,774,840 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 5 8 10 20 40 59 83 118 166 236 295 332 415 443 472 590 664 830 886 1,180 1,660 1,772 2,215 2,360 3,320 3,544 4,430 4,897 8,860 9,794 17,720 19,588 24,485 26,137 36,769 39,176 48,970 52,274 73,538 97,940 104,548 130,685 147,076 183,845 195,880 209,096 261,370 294,152 367,690 522,740 735,380 1,045,480 1,470,760 2,169,371 4,338,742 8,677,484 10,846,855 17,354,968 21,693,710 43,387,420 and 86,774,840, with no remainder.

Since 86,774,840 cannot be divided by just 1 and 86,774,840, it is a composite number.
